The A/C blows out of the top (near the windshield), and below (at the feet), but not at your body from the middle.

What kind of problem is this, I have no idea where to start, and just tearing into the dash seems kinda harsh...

It could be the vacuum line.
Get your head into the passenger foot well and look up under the dash next to the center console and look for a vacuum control cylinder, (brass in color). A yellow vacuum line should be connected to the side of it via a nipple. If it is disconnected, you will have the problem you described.

the vacum control!!

its not on the passenger side its on drivers side towards center of car behind the door/igniton dinger and to relays are in that location its behind their when u flip your switch control it should b movin one way or the other if its not check the clear vinyl line that is the vacum line remove it and hold your thumb over opening in the line u should feel suction when u move control one way and release when moved to another positon if you feel this transfer line is ok then it will probably be a bad vacuum diapgram. if you donot feel a trans fer of vacuum then it could be in your switch control!! i have my dash apart now if you need photos let me know i will take them of everything you should look for!!

check the little beer keg with thw yellow line and if its not that check the vacuum coupling under the glove box i had the same problem and it was one of the lines by the glove box. good luck phil
